[QUOTE="jncuse, post: 5283269, member: 1969"] Updates as the third of 4 "tiers" of OOC play are about to completed... week 5 and 6. I'll put the tables up tomorrow as week 6 is officially complete. But the highlights (lowlights?) for the ACC are; - Clearly now 5th behind the BE... they are about as close to the MWC as the BE. They are trending worse - Won 20% of Q1 games (9W, 35L) - Won 38% of Q2 games (9-15) - Won 26% of Q1+Q2 games (18-50) - 20-52 (against the other top conferences and Q1-Q2 games against schools from out of the conferences. - 4-28 vs the SEC, 16-24 vs Others The SEC dominance continues -- far greater than anything I have ever seen in OOC play --- you might be looking at a 12 team league. Or if there end up being 5 or 6 league bottom feeders in the SEC, you might have 8 teams on the top 4 seed lines. - They have won 61% of Q1 games... no other conference has won more than 34% (ACC 20%) - They have won 89% of Q2 games, next best is 57% (B10) (ACC 38%) - They have won 72% of Q1+Q2 games, next best is 43% (B10) (ACC 26%) - SEC is 63-19 (77%) against other top conferences or Q1+Q2 schools out of the top conference. They are 37-15 excluding the ACC. The next best conference in these games is the B10 at 49%. (ACC 28%) - [B]The SEC has 50 quality wins, 1 bad loss, No other conference has more than 23. ACC is 18 quality W, 10 bad losses,[/B] Overall in terms of margin, which is relevant for NET the SEC is 16.3, B10 is 13.9, and B12 is 13.4. B12 keeps it status up due to enhanced performance in Q4 games. I'll post more on B12 in a single topic, [/QUOTE]
